  2. Stewart Barton says:

    Non-choir versions of Once In Royal David’s City:
    Sufjan Stevens from Hark! Songs for Christmas Volume 2

    The Seekers from Morningtown Ride To Christmas

    Robin Gibb from My Favorite Carols

    Stan Kenton (big band jazz instrumental version)

    The Albion Christmas Band from Winter Songs
